Graptoveria 'A Grim One'

  •  Graptoveria ‘A Grim One’ (Grim) is a beautifully sculpted succulent with a clean, upright presence and a quietly dramatic color palette. Its tight rosette is made up of thick, fleshy leaves in a soft silver-blue tone, giving the plant a calm, almost stone-like look. As light levels increase, the pointed leaf tips gently blush pink, adding a subtle pop of color without overpowering the rosette’s elegant form.
     
     When mature, it produces tall flower stalks topped with sunny yellow blooms lightly speckled in red, creating a striking contrast against the cool-toned foliage.


  •  Bright Indoor Light, Full Sun
    Gritty, well-draining soil is essential. Use a cactus and succulent mix with 50%-70% mineral grit such as coarse sand, pumice, or perlite.

    Water infrequently. Allow soil to dry out completely between waterings. Avoid letting water sit in the rosette to prevent rot.

    Non-toxic to dogs, cats, and horses (Pet-friendly).

  • Zone 10
